Critical Considerations for Commercial Production

While the potential is high, there are specific scenarios where Tree Mini Embroidery must be used with caution. As a designer, I advise against using this file blindly on all substrates. The intricate detailing of the exposed roots requires sufficient stitch density to remain legible. If the design is scaled too small for a tiny logo on a pen or a very narrow cuff, those root details may merge into a solid blob of thread.

Furthermore, the choice of fabric texture is crucial. On highly textured fabrics like heavy canvas or thick fleece, fine details can get lost. I recommend testing the design on the actual material intended for production before committing to a large run. Dark uniforms also present a challenge; if the background thread is dark, the light-colored canopy might require extensive underlay to prevent show-through. Always verify the thread colors contrast sufficiently with the base fabric to maintain brand recognition.

Another area of concern is frequent washing. Items like baby clothes or kitchen aprons undergo rigorous laundering. Ensure the hoop size allows for proper tension during stitching so the threads do not loosen over time. Using the correct stabilizer is non-negotiable here; a tear-away stabilizer might suffice for stable wovens, but a cut-away is safer for stretchy knits to prevent puckering around the tree trunk.

Practical Designer Notes for Implementation

Before integrating Tree Mini Embroidery into your commercial workflow, follow these practical steps to ensure success:

  1. Test in Black and White: Before selecting vibrant thread colors, run a test stitch in black. This reveals the structural integrity of the design and highlights any gaps in the root details.
  2. Verify Scale: Check if the design maintains clarity at your intended patch size. Do not assume the default size is optimal for your specific application.
  3. Inspect Spacing: Ensure there is enough space between the tree and any accompanying text. Crowding text around the canopy can ruin the balance.
  4. Confirm Licensing: Always confirm commercial licensing terms before using any digital embroidery file for business. You need explicit permission to sell items featuring this design.
  5. Create Mockups: Generate a printable mockup to show clients or stakeholders how the finished product will look. Visualizing the design on a cap or apron helps secure approval.
  6. Compare Assets: Place the tree beside other design assets in your brand kit to ensure visual harmony in color and style.
